Dripping Roof RepairDetermine the Source: Start by finding the source of the leak. This could be a damaged seal, a broken roof panel, or a loose fitting.Seal the Leak: Apply a high-quality sealant to any gaps or cracks. Silicone sealant is a popular option for its durability and versatility.Replace Damaged Panels: If a roof panel is beyond repair, think about changing it. PVC or polycarbonate panels are economical and simple to install.Professional Help: For more severe leaks, it might be needed to seek advice from a professional. They can offer an extensive solution and make sure the repair is done correctly.2. Fixing Broken WindowsAssess the Damage: Determine whether the [window safety](https://scientific-programs.science/wiki/A_Complete_Guide_To_Lock_Troubleshooting) can be repaired or needs to be changed. Small fractures can typically be repaired with a clear adhesive, while larger breaks need a new pane.DIY Repair: For small fractures, tidy the area and apply a clear epoxy resin. Follow the maker's instructions for the very best results.Replacement: If the damage is comprehensive, replace the [window locking system](https://morphomics.science/wiki/Five_Reasons_To_Join_An_Online_Home_Security_Shop_And_5_Reasons_Why_You_Shouldnt) pane. Procedure the measurements thoroughly and acquire a new pane from a local hardware shop.Professional Installation: If you're not comfortable with DIY repairs, a professional can change the [window hardware](https://harrell-sullivan-3.technetbloggers.de/could-window-lock-repairs-be-the-key-to-2024s-resolving-3f) for you.3. Attending To Structural DamageCheck the Frame: Check for any indications of rot, warping, or weakening in the frame. This can be a sign of more major structural issues.Enhance Weak Points: Use metal brackets or enhancing strips to strengthen weak areas. This can be an affordable method to enhance stability.Replace Damaged Components: If parts of the frame are severely damaged, they may need to be changed. PVC or aluminum are long lasting and affordable materials for this function.Consult a Structural Engineer: For substantial structural issues, it's recommended to consult a structural engineer. They can provide an in-depth evaluation and advise the very best course of action.4. Improving Sealing and InsulationExamine Seals: Inspect the seals around windows, doors, and roof panels. Replace any that are worn or damaged.Add Weather Stripping: Install weather removing around windows and doors to enhance insulation and minimize drafts.Insulate the Roof: Consider including insulation to the roof to improve energy performance. Reflective foil or foam insulation can be efficient and relatively affordable.Seal Gaps: Use broadening foam to seal any spaces or cracks in the conservatory's structure. This can assist prevent drafts and improve insulation.5. Maintaining Furniture and FittingsTidy Regularly: Dust and clean the conservatory frequently to avoid accumulation and damage.Protect Furniture: Use protective covers for furnishings when not in use, particularly during the cold weather.Repair or Replace: For damaged fittings, think about repairing or changing them. Q: How often should I check my conservatory for damage?

A: It's an excellent idea to check your conservatory at least as soon as a year. This can help you recognize and resolve issues before they become more major and expensive to fix.

Q: Can I repair a leaking roof myself?

A: Minor leaks can typically be fixed with a high-quality sealant. Nevertheless, for more extreme leaks, it's best to seek advice from a professional to make sure the repair is done properly and securely.

Q: What are the signs of structural damage in a conservatory?

A: Signs of structural damage consist of cracks in the frame, warping, and weakening. If you observe any of these issues, it is essential to address them without delay to avoid more damage.

Q: How can I improve the insulation in my conservatory?

A: Adding weather stripping, sealing gaps with broadening foam, and insulating the roof can all help improve insulation and lower energy expenses.
